Accelerators for the Amiga 600 are hard to come by. Right now there is an opportunity for a new production of the Apollo 630 if interest exists.


Product Information:
Apollo 630

A small batch of the accellerator board (68030@40 MHz, SIMM socket for up to 32MB RAM, socket for 68882 FPU) will get produced if at least 50 people order a board. A single board would cost 130 EUR (incl. VAT).

If you're interested, please contact Matthias Bertram through e-mail. Until now, Matthias has collected three orders.
